How Laser Cutting Works

A high-powered laser beam is focused onto a material, heating it so intensely that it melts, burns, or vaporises. This process is controlled by computer software to achieve micrometre-level precision.

Materials That Can Be Laser Cut

Steel, aluminium, titanium, plastics, wood, leather, even stone — laser cutting can handle an incredible variety of materials. The key is selecting the correct wavelength and power settings for each material’s unique properties.

Advantages Over Traditional Cutting Methods

  • Precision: Perfectly smooth edges with no need for secondary finishing.
  • Speed: Complex shapes cut in seconds.
  • Versatility: Works on both delicate and heavy-duty projects.
  • Consistency: Identical results every time, even in large production runs.

Industries Relying on Laser Cutting

From aerospace to signage, automotive manufacturing to fashion, laser cutting is a critical tool for both heavy industry and creative design. Its adaptability makes it one of the most valuable technologies in modern production.
